视觉系统实用指南:OpenCV基础与应用
在进行视觉和图像分析系统的实验或为实际目的实现此类系统时,基本的软件基础设施至关重要。图像由像素组成,一个典型的数码相机图像可能包含400 - 600万个像素,每个像素代表图像中某一点的颜色。这些大量的数据以适合商业软件(如Photoshop和Paint)处理的格式(如GIF或JPEG)存储为文件。开发新的图像分析软件,首先要能够将这些文件读取为允许访问像素值的内部形式。这虽然并不复杂,也不涉及实际的图像处理,但却是必不可少的第一步。
1. OpenCV简介
OpenCV最初由英特尔开发。当前版本是2.0,可从 http://sourceforge.net/projects/opencvlibrary/ 下载。不过,2.0版本相对较新,并非能在所有主流系统和编译器上安装和编译。本文示例使用的是1.1版本,可从 http://sourceforge.net/projects/opencvlibrary/files/opencv-win/1.1pre1/OpenCV_1.1pre1a.exe/download 下载,并使用Microsoft Visual C++ 2008 Express Edition进行编译,该编译器可从
超级会员免费看
订阅专栏 解锁全文
9万+

被折叠的 条评论
为什么被折叠?



